Rigetti Demonstrates Industry’s Largest Multi-Chip Quantum Computer; Halves Two-Qubit Gate Error Rate
Globenewswire· 2025-07-16 11:30
Core Insights - Rigetti Computing has achieved a mid-year performance milestone of 99.5% median two-qubit gate fidelity on its modular 36-qubit system, marking a 2x reduction in median two-qubit gate error rate compared to its previous best results [1] - The 36-qubit system, composed of four 9-qubit chiplets, is based on proprietary modular chip technology and paves the way for a 100+ qubit chiplet-based system, which is expected to be released before the end of 2025 [1][2] - Rigetti plans to launch its 36-qubit system on August 15, 2025, and aims to maintain the same fidelity for the upcoming 100+ qubit system [1] Company Overview - Rigetti Computing is a pioneer in full-stack quantum computing, operating quantum computers over the cloud since 2017 and serving various clients through its Rigetti Quantum Cloud Services platform [3] - The company began selling on-premises quantum computing systems in 2021, with qubit counts ranging from 24 to 84, and introduced the 9-qubit Novera™ QPU in 2023 to support R&D [3] - Rigetti has developed the industry's first multi-chip quantum processor for scalable quantum computing systems and manufactures its chips in-house at Fab-1, the first dedicated quantum device manufacturing facility [3]

Spectral Capital Corporation Signs Agreement to Acquire 42 Telecom Ltd., a Global Leader in Messaging Infrastructure
Prnewswire· 2025-07-15 11:03
Core Viewpoint - Spectral Capital Corporation has entered into a binding agreement to acquire 100% of the equity of 42 Telecom Ltd., a Maltese-based telecommunications infrastructure provider, marking a strategic expansion into high-growth areas such as enterprise messaging, AI-enhanced fraud prevention, and quantum-integrated blockchain technology [1][4]. Company Overview - Spectral Capital Corporation is a deep technology company focused on AI technology and Quantum Computing, with over 20 years of expertise in accelerating emerging technologies [7][8]. - 42 Telecom Ltd. is recognized as a leading provider of international messaging infrastructure, particularly known for its SMS traffic into Vietnam, delivering billions of messages annually [2][9]. Transaction Details - Under the acquisition agreement, Spectral will issue 8,000,000 shares of common stock to Heritage Ventures Ltd., the sole shareholder of 42 Telecom, with an additional 8,000,000 shares placed in escrow for earnout and valuation protection tied to 42 Telecom's financial performance in 2025 and 2026, guaranteeing revenues of $15 million in 2025 [3]. - The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ions, including regulatory and board approvals, and upon closing, 42 Telecom will become a wholly owned subsidiary of Spectral [6]. Strategic Implications - The acquisition provides Spectral access to advanced messaging infrastructure and a unique position in Southeast Asian markets, enhancing its enterprise client base [4]. - The combined capabilities of Spectral's technologies in compression, fraud prevention, and data mining, along with 42 Telecom's messaging gateway and compliance tools, will target enterprise messaging use cases in sectors such as healthcare, finance, and government [4][5]. Intellectual Property and Innovation - The acquisition is expected to add numerous patentable inventions to Spectral's intellectual property portfolio, including next-generation fraud detection and blockchain-integrated messaging verification frameworks developed by 42 Telecom [5].
